What to do when stock price goes down ? Buy more, Sell, Hold ?

How do I know what to do when stock price goes down ?
Should I buy more stock, sell it or hold it ?

Frequently asked question. The right answer may worth billions or even trillions sometimes.

First, you need to know why is stock price going down.
  • Is market crashing or is industry crashing or is the specific business crashing ?
  • Is stock price of competitors going down as well ?
  • Is company in declining industry ?


If there is a high probability, that stock price will rise in the future, then hold the stock or buy more (if the price is too low).

If there is a high probability, that stock price will not rise in the future, then you should consider to sell the stock, to protect your money and minimize losses.
What you should definitely do when market drops is:
  • Avoid panic - Emotional behavior may cause you to do bad decisions.
  • Do not ignore risk limits
"Buying the dip" is a good investment strategy. But before buying a low priced stock, you have to be sure enough, that there is a high probability of price rebound.

When stock price goes down, it can be a good opportunity to buy more. This investment strategy is called "buying the dip".

Before you buy "discounted" stock, you have find out why is its price going down.

There are some situations when it can be smart to buy the dip.

You have to consider to buy more stock if:
  • Price is going down, because whole market is going down.
  • Price is going down due to Pre-earnings pullback. In this case, the price drops a couple of days before company releases its quaterly financial reports. If company's economic performance is good, stock price usually rebounds quickly. But if company does not meet expectations, then stock price goes down even more.
  • Price is going down, because of profit taking. This can be difficult to recognize.
  • Price is going down, because of company's short-term economic underperformance.


It is not recommended to buy more stock if:
  • Stock price is going down, because company is losing its competitiveness for a longer period of time. This may happen due to lack of innovations
  • Stock price is going down, because company is losing its market share for a longer period of time. It can be related to losing of competitiveness.
  • Company is in declining industry.
  • Company has many competitors and their stock prices are rising.
  • There is a significant probability that stock price will not rebound.
  • There is a significant probability that company's market share will be decreased in the future. For example, because of geopolitics etc.
